本帖最后由 yezi8803 于 2018-8-10 23:27 编辑
1、ListView增加上拉滚动到底的事件,用以实现自动加载分页。
2、linechart控件能否实现滚动(主要是横向滚动),linechart能否实现不同的数据点可以设置不同颜色,点与点之间的连线可以设置弧线。
3、安卓的重连机制需要优化,现在安卓机器在应用切换到后台一段时间之后,再切换回来,会出现长时间的重连并最后提示网络无响应,随即才恢复正常。
4、PANEL嵌套时能否不屏蔽滚动。
5、zoomimage能否实现获取屏幕点击坐标,用来实现点击图片不同部分可以打开不同功能.
6、在应用后台被关闭后再打开时,能否增加一个事件(例如在这个事件里可以判断是否已在别的设备登录了等等)。
7、能否提供蓝牙相关插件,用来扫描设备,建立连接,接收和发送数据。
8、第三方插件能否增加和RN窗体(SMO窗体)的交互,在第三方插件的事件或方法中可以调用RN方(SMO)的窗口,看过网上的一些例子,原生程序(包括安卓和IOS)都是可以调用RN窗体的;这样可以避免在SMO中已经实现的功能,还要到原生里再实现一遍。
9、作为对第8条的扩充,IM插件能否实现单聊窗口的中的头像点击事件和点击底部加号的plugin的自定义,并在事件中实现对SMO功能的调用。这样IM功能和扩展性将得到极大提升。
10、IM插件在打开会话窗口和单聊窗口方法中能否增加回调,用以在打开的原生窗口关闭时执行一些操作。
11、IM插件能否增加主动获取未读消息数的方法,或者是未读消息事件也可以在阅读消息后被触发(原来的未读消息事件只在有新消息时才被触发,消息被阅读后无法获得剩余的未读消息数)。
12、mobileform的statusbar能否增加高度属性,可以在运行时获得高度,这样在实现沉浸式状态栏时可以根据不同的机型来决定高度,实现更美观的效果。
13、SMO服务端的运行机制是什么,能否支持微软的NLB或类似的负载均衡技术?因为负载均衡要求服务端是无状态的。我们在服务端程序里定义的变量,是保存在手机客户端还是服务端,还有会话SESSION是否也是保存在服务端的内存里,如果是保存在服务端的话,就很难实现负载均衡,因为每一次连接,负载均衡可能根据实际负载情况将访问分配到不同的服务器,如果SMO能指定SESSION的存储位置(比如存储在数据库中或专门的State Server中)那就可以实现负载均衡。SMO的服务端实现机制如果能支持负载均衡,将使SMO的应用范围得到极大的扩展,可以支持真正企业级的应用。
14、SMO的IOS打包能否设置是支持IPHONE还是IPAD,不要像现在似的,打包出来就是两者都支持。因为在苹果审核时,只要你的应用是支持IPAD的,苹果必定首先用IPAD来测试应用,有的时候没注意IPAD的适配就会造成过不了审。
以上是我对Smobiler的建议,希望SMO能采纳。最后真诚祝福SMO能越做越好,成为APP开发的首选平台! |